Kate Morrison 1883–1945 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 5 May 1883

Birth Location: Seymour, Wayne County, Iowa, United States of America

Death Date: 13 August 1945

Death Location: Ellensburg, Kittitas County, Washington, United States of America

Father: James Morrison

Mother: Jane Steele

Spouse(s): Tony Bucklin

Children(s): Elizebeth Bucklin

The story of Kate Morrison began in 1883 in Seymour, Wayne County, Iowa, United States of America. In 1909, Kate Morrison established residence. In 1910, Kate Morrison resided in Marshalltown Ward 2, Marshall, Iowa, USA. Kate Morrison married Tony Jasper Bucklin, and had children including Elizebeth L Bucklin. Kate Morrison passed away in 1945 in Ellensburg, Kittitas County, Washington, United States of America.
